3D Face HRN开源大模型部署教程:ModelScope镜像一键拉取运行
3D Face HRN开源大模型部署教程ModelScope镜像一键拉取运行想从2D照片快速生成专业级3D人脸模型这个教程将手把手教你部署高精度人脸重建系统无需3D建模经验一张照片就能创建逼真的3D人脸。1. 环境准备与快速部署1.1 系统要求在开始之前请确保你的系统满足以下基本要求操作系统Linux (Ubuntu 18.04 推荐) 或 Windows WSL2Python版本3.8 或更高版本内存至少 8GB RAM存储空间5GB 以上可用空间网络稳定的互联网连接用于下载模型权重推荐配置如果你有NVIDIA GPU建议使用CUDA 11.7环境这样可以大幅提升处理速度。1.2 一键部署步骤部署过程非常简单只需几个命令就能完成# 克隆项目仓库如果提供 git clone https://github.com/username/3d-face-hrn.git cd 3d-face-hrn # 安装依赖包 pip install -r requirements.txt # 启动应用 bash /root/start.sh等待安装完成后终端会显示运行地址通常是http://0.0.0.0:8080在浏览器中打开这个链接就能看到操作界面。2. 核心功能快速了解这个3D人脸重建系统基于先进的深度学习技术能够将普通的2D照片转换为专业的3D模型。主要功能包括高精度3D重建使用ResNet50深度学习模型能够精准捕捉面部特征和轮廓UV纹理生成自动创建展平的纹理贴图可以直接用在Blender、Unity等3D软件中智能处理自动检测人脸、调整图片大小、转换颜色格式全程无需手动干预友好界面基于Gradio的现代化界面实时显示处理进度操作简单直观3. 分步使用指南3.1 上传人脸照片打开网页界面后你会看到左侧的上传区域# 系统会自动进行以下处理 1. 检测图片中的人脸位置 2. 自动调整图片大小到合适尺寸 3. 转换颜色格式BGR到RGB 4. 标准化数据格式拍照建议使用正面照眼睛直视镜头光线均匀避免强烈阴影背景简洁减少干扰不要戴眼镜、口罩等遮挡物证件照效果最佳3.2 开始3D重建点击 开始3D重建按钮后系统会依次进行预处理检测和裁剪人脸区域几何计算分析面部3D结构纹理生成创建详细的皮肤纹理整个过程通常需要1-3分钟具体时间取决于你的硬件配置。界面顶部的进度条会实时显示当前处理阶段。3.3 查看和保存结果处理完成后右侧会显示生成的UV纹理贴图# 生成的纹理贴图包含 - 面部颜色和皮肤纹理 - 所有面部特征的精确映射 - 可直接导入3D软件的格式你可以右键点击图片选择另存为或者使用系统提供的下载按钮保存结果。4. 实际效果展示为了让你更直观地了解效果这里展示几个生成案例案例1标准证件照输入正面免冠照片输出高精度3D纹理完美还原皮肤细节和面部特征案例2生活照处理输入自然光线下的半身照输出清晰的3D模型即使原图光线一般也能很好处理案例3不同人种适配系统能够准确处理各种肤色和人种特征保持各自的面部特征同时生成准确的3D模型从测试效果来看系统在处理正面清晰照片时表现最佳生成的面部纹理细节丰富包括皮肤毛孔、眉毛毛发等细微特征都能很好保留。5. 常见问题解决5.1 人脸检测失败如果系统提示未检测到人脸可以尝试裁剪图片让人脸占据更大比例调整光线避免过暗或过曝确保面部没有严重遮挡尝试不同的照片角度5.2 处理速度较慢提升处理速度的方法# 如果有GPU确保正确配置CUDA nvidia-smi # 检查GPU状态 # 关闭其他占用资源的程序 # 使用更高配置的硬件环境5.3 生成质量优化为了获得最佳效果使用高清原图建议1024x1024以上确保面部清晰对焦选择中性表情的照片避免化妆过重影响面部特征6. 进阶使用技巧6.1 批量处理多张照片虽然界面每次处理一张照片但你可以通过修改代码实现批量处理import os from reconstruction_utils import process_image # 批量处理文件夹中的所有图片 image_folder path/to/your/photos output_folder path/to/output for filename in os.listdir(image_folder): if filename.endswith((.jpg, .png, .jpeg)): image_path os.path.join(image_folder, filename) result process_image(image_path) # 保存结果...6.2 与其他3D软件集成生成的UV纹理贴图可以直接用于主流3D软件Blender使用步骤创建基础人脸模型导入生成的纹理贴图调整材质和渲染设置Unity/Unreal Engine集成将纹理作为材质应用调整着色器获得最佳效果用于游戏角色或虚拟形象创建7. 总结通过这个教程你已经学会了如何快速部署和使用3D Face HRN人脸重建系统。这个工具的优势在于简单易用一键部署网页操作无需专业技术背景效果专业生成的3D模型质量高满足专业需求实用性强结果可直接用于各种3D软件和游戏引擎免费开源基于Apache 2.0协议可以自由使用和修改无论你是3D建模爱好者、游戏开发者还是只是对AI技术感兴趣这个工具都能为你提供强大的3D人脸创建能力。尝试上传自己的照片体验从2D到3D的神奇转换吧获取更多AI镜像想探索更多AI镜像和应用场景访问 CSDN星图镜像广场提供丰富的预置镜像覆盖大模型推理、图像生成、视频生成、模型微调等多个领域支持一键部署。

相关新闻

UEViewer:虚幻引擎资产处理与3D资源提取的跨版本解决方案

UEViewer:虚幻引擎资产处理与3D资源提取的跨版本解决方案

UEViewer:虚幻引擎资产处理与3D资源提取的跨版本解决方案 【免费下载链接】UEViewer Viewer and exporter for Unreal Engine 1-4 assets (UE Viewer). 项目地址: https://gitcode.com/gh_mirrors/ue/UEViewer 虚幻引擎资产处理在游戏开发与资源分析领域具有…

2026/5/17 6:02:00 阅读更多 →
GTE-Chinese-Large模型参数详解:中文语义向量嵌入维度与性能平衡点

GTE-Chinese-Large模型参数详解:中文语义向量嵌入维度与性能平衡点

GTE-Chinese-Large模型参数详解:中文语义向量嵌入维度与性能平衡点 1. 模型核心参数解析 GTE-Chinese-Large作为专门针对中文优化的语义向量模型,其参数设计在语义理解能力和计算效率之间找到了精妙的平衡点。 1.1 嵌入维度设计原理 GTE-Chinese-Lar…

2026/5/17 6:02:00 阅读更多 →
【Seedance 2.0 Node.js 部署权威指南】:20年架构师亲测的3种集成路径与隐性成本避坑清单

【Seedance 2.0 Node.js 部署权威指南】:20年架构师亲测的3种集成路径与隐性成本避坑清单

第一章:Seedance 2.0 Node.js 部署收费标准对比总览Seedance 2.0 提供面向企业级应用的 Node.js 运行时托管服务,其部署方案按资源隔离性、SLA 保障等级与运维支持深度划分为三类:基础版、专业版与企业版。各版本在 CPU/内存配额、自动扩缩容…

2026/5/17 6:01:59 阅读更多 →

最新新闻

本科生论文写作利器:AI工具全流程指南

本科生论文写作利器:AI工具全流程指南

1. 本科生论文写作痛点与AI工具价值 写毕业论文是每个本科生都要经历的"成人礼",但现实中90%的学生都会遇到这些典型问题:文献综述找不到方向、数据分析耗时费力、格式调整反复折腾、查重降重痛苦不堪。作为带过上百篇本科论文的指导老师&…

2026/7/4 12:43:07 阅读更多 →
如何3步完成iOS激活锁绕过:面向A9-A11设备的完整指南

如何3步完成iOS激活锁绕过:面向A9-A11设备的完整指南

如何3步完成iOS激活锁绕过:面向A9-A11设备的完整指南 【免费下载链接】applera1n icloud bypass for ios 15-16 项目地址: https://gitcode.com/gh_mirrors/ap/applera1n 你是否曾遇到过这样的情况:购买二手iPhone后却卡在激活锁界面无法使用&…

2026/7/4 12:39:05 阅读更多 →
Android ML Kit人脸比对技术实现与优化

Android ML Kit人脸比对技术实现与优化

1. Android ML Kit 人脸比对技术解析在移动应用开发中,人脸识别技术已经成为身份验证、社交互动等场景的核心功能。Google提供的ML Kit人脸识别API为开发者提供了便捷高效的解决方案。不同于传统的人脸比对方式(如直接比较像素值)&#xff0c…

2026/7/4 12:39:05 阅读更多 →
机器学习可观测性实战:构建数据-模型-业务三层健康保障体系

机器学习可观测性实战:构建数据-模型-业务三层健康保障体系

1. 项目概述:这不是一次模型训练,而是一场交付实战“From Notebook to Production: Running ML in the Real World (Part 4)”——光看标题,你可能以为这是某套系列教程的第四讲,讲点模型部署或API封装。但如果你真在一线做过三个…

2026/7/4 12:37:05 阅读更多 →
STM32与LP5812实现动态灯光控制方案

STM32与LP5812实现动态灯光控制方案

1. 项目背景与硬件选型解析 在嵌入式系统开发中,动态灯光效果已经成为提升用户交互体验的重要手段。这次我选择了STM32F429ZI作为主控芯片,搭配德州仪器的LP5812 RGB LED驱动器,构建了一套高灵活性的灯光控制系统。这个组合特别适合需要复杂灯…

2026/7/4 12:37:05 阅读更多 →
深度学习优化器对比实验:固定网络下6种optimizer性能全解析

深度学习优化器对比实验:固定网络下6种optimizer性能全解析

1. 项目概述:为什么同一个神经网络要换着 optimizer 跑? “Training the Same Neural Network with Different Optimizers”——这个标题看起来像一句实验课作业要求,但背后藏着深度学习实践中最常被忽视、却影响最深远的底层逻辑&#xff1a…

2026/7/4 12:37:05 阅读更多 →

日新闻

Memcached 1.6.43 发布:关键安全修复版本,多项问题得到解决

Memcached 1.6.43 发布:关键安全修复版本,多项问题得到解决

Memcached 1.6.43 正式发布,这是一个关键的安全修复版本,修复了多个方面的问题,还对部分功能进行了优化。 安全修复亮点 此次发布在安全修复上表现突出。binprot 避免了项目引用计数溢出,mcmc 因安全问题提升了上游版本号&#xf…

2026/7/4 0:04:29 阅读更多 →
终极指南:使用HMCL启动器跨平台畅玩Minecraft的完整解决方案

终极指南:使用HMCL启动器跨平台畅玩Minecraft的完整解决方案

终极指南:使用HMCL启动器跨平台畅玩Minecraft的完整解决方案 【免费下载链接】HMCL A Minecraft Launcher which is multi-functional, cross-platform and popular 项目地址: https://gitcode.com/gh_mirrors/hm/HMCL HMCL(Hello Minecraft! Lau…

2026/7/4 0:06:29 阅读更多 →
KMX63与PIC18F66K40在嵌入式HMI中的硬件协同与低功耗设计

KMX63与PIC18F66K40在嵌入式HMI中的硬件协同与低功耗设计

1. KMX63与PIC18F66K40的硬件协同架构解析KMX63作为一款三轴加速度计和磁力计组合传感器,与PIC18F66K40微控制器的搭配堪称嵌入式HMI开发的黄金组合。这套硬件组合的核心优势在于KMX63提供的高精度运动感知能力与PIC18F66K40强大的信号处理能力形成了完美互补。KMX6…

2026/7/4 0:06:29 阅读更多 →

周新闻

月新闻